Kentucky Derby fastest times: Secretariat owns best mark at Churchill Downs

The Kentucky Derby is famously known as the “Fastest Two Minutes in Sports.”

After days, weeks and months of anticipation, including a two-week festival in Louisville built around the event, the race is over relatively quickly, with tens of thousands of big-hatted, mint–julep-soaked fans cheering frantically as nearly two dozen horses sprint around a 1¼ mile dirt track.

Sometimes, though, it doesn’t even take two full minutes.

On Saturday, the 151st edition of the Kentucky Derby will take place at Churchill Downs. A field of 20 competitors will square off for immortality in the sport’s most iconic event, with a garland of roses, a chance at a Triple Crown and millions of dollars on the line (along with some, ahem, nice post-retirement benefits for the winning horse).

A horse’s attempts at history go beyond the other equines galloping around it on the first Saturday in May. With a fast enough time, a horse can cement its place among some of the most decorated figures in horse-racing history.

In advance of Saturday’s Kentucky Derby, here’s a look at the fastest times ever at the Derby:

Fastest time in Kentucky Derby history

The fastest time in Kentucky Derby history belongs to perhaps the sport’s most celebrated horse.

Secretariat completed the Kentucky Derby faster than any horse in history, finishing in first place in 1973 with a time of 1:59.40, beating second-place Sham by two-and-a-half lengths.

Kentucky Derby fastest times

Here’s a look at some of the other fastest times in Derby history:

  1. 1973, Secretariat: 1:59.40

  2. 2001, Monarchos: 1:59.97

  3. 1964, Northern Dancer: 2:00.00

  4. 1985, Spend A Buck: 2:00.20

  5. 1962, Decidedly: 2:00.40

  6. 1967, Proud Clarion: 2:00.60

  7. 2020, Authentic: 2:00.61

  8. 1996, Grindstone: 2:01.06

Kentucky Derby favorite 2025

Journalism is the favorite among the 20 horses in the 2025 Kentucky Derby field, with 7-2 odds (as of Thursday evening). On April 5, Journalism won the Santa Anita Derby, one of the major races in the leadup to the Kentucky Derby.
